Illegal VoIP Activities: Four Mobile Operators Fined Tk 8 Crore 86 Lakh
Bangladesh Telecommunication Regulatory Commission (BTRC) has imposed a total administrative fine of Tk 8 crore 86 lakh 20 thousand on four mobile operators for detection of SIMs used in illegal international call termination (VoIP) activities. The accused operators are: Robi Axiata, Banglalink, Teletalk, and Grameenphone.

According to BTRC, evidence has been found that a total of 8,682 SIMs of these operators were used in illegal VoIP activities. The commission has directed the concerned operators to pay the fine within the next 10 days. A notice signed by BTRC Director Sohel Rana has been sent to the chief executive officers of the respective companies.

In the list of fines, Robi Axiata has been given the highest penalty. The company was fined Tk 5 crore 93 lakh 50 thousand for 5,935 SIMs used in illegal VoIP activities.

Banglalink was fined Tk 1 crore 88 lakh 20 thousand as evidence of 1,882 SIMs being used in similar activities.

Additionally, state-owned mobile operator Teletalk was fined Tk 68 lakh 10 thousand for 681 SIMs used in illegal VoIP activities, and Grameenphone was fined Tk 18 lakh 40 thousand for evidence of 184 SIMs used.

In the BTRC notice, it was stated that the concerned operators failed to take effective measures to prevent illegal international call termination according to the Bangladesh Telecommunication Regulatory Act, mobile operator license conditions, and commission directives. As a result, their SIMs were used in illegal VoIP activities.

The commission further informed that an administrative fine of Tk 10,000 per SIM used in illegal VoIP activities has been determined. Separate notices in this regard were sent to the four operators on July 21 last.

It is noteworthy that after the fine on Grameenphone came to light on Saturday (July 25) night, information about fines on the remaining three mobile operators on the same charge also emerged.
